Hey there all,

Since  few days I use Windows 10 technical preview as my Operating System. I like it alot. Ofcourse there are still a few things which can be done better, but there already are some huge improvements.
  • Like on your phone we have a notification center now, which is really helpful. You can track any notifcations, they say even from your phone (if you have a windows phone)! Which can be really useful for people like me who wants to work convertable
  • Start menu is improved but not the best yet. It can be done way better then it is now, but it's going in the right direction.
  • Metro apps as normal windows, which is really helpfull because I use the mail app from windows alot, because it sync with my gmail and my windows phone mail app. So, now I can organize it all way better.
  • Internet Explorer is insane improved! It is way faster in starting up and browsing the web. The website loads instantly, way faster then Chrome and opera do for me. Great job microsoft!
  • Virtual Desktop, like a new floor opened in heaven. Multitasking is so much faster then it was before. Mainly I used Linux for this, but now we have it on windows, and it's very very very good!
  • Tablet modus, If you want everything to be fullscreen touch optimized anyway you can always have the tablet modus enabled. Every app and the startmenu is fullscreen en works just like in windows 8.1
  • Smart Snap, Microsoft extended their snapping feature to make it available to snap up to 4 windows on 1 desktop easily, which can be really helpful.
  • Theme, the theme is more sleek and fancier, the borders are removed which has a nice effect. But it has it downsides because I totally doesn't like the window buttons for normal windows. They don't fit the rest of the theme.
  • Improved FPS, again, Microsoft did an amazing job improving FPS on weak video cards. Mainly becuase the theme  a lot easier to handle than the ugly Aero system.
  • Cortana arrives in windows! Which is really helpful if you are lonely and want to talk to your computer, or when you are working and want to make an appointment while doing other stuff.
